Francis Hotel Bath
51.383003, -2.363429The 4-star Francis Hotel Bath is situated merely a 6-minute walk from Museum of East Asian Art and provides luxurious rooms, which are within a 5-minute drive of The Duck Pond. Opened in 1753, the boutique hotel welcomes guests in the Upper Town district of Bath and boasts a central location near a train station.
Location
The environmentally friendly property is located in the very heart of Bath, nearly a 5-minute drive from No. 1 Royal Crescent and relatively close to Pulteney Bridge. The Francis Hotel Bath offers proximity to such natural sights as the 18th-century Prior Park (2.8 km) and Bath City Farm (2.5 km). The accommodation is situated within 15 minutes' walk of Henrietta Park, and Bath bus station lies about a 5-minute walk away.
For those travelling from afar, Bristol airport is 39 minutes' drive away.
Rooms
The Francis Hotel features 98 rooms with a TV set, as well as a mini-fridge-bar. Guests can also use a rain shower and an additional toilet, along with such amenities as hairdryers and complimentary toiletries. Some units boast glorious views of the city.
Eat & Drink
This Bath hotel offers breakfast in the restaurant. Boho Marche restaurant serves Mediterranean cuisine for lunch. Guests can enjoy dining at the à la carte restaurant, which comprises a spacious terrace. The lounge bar is ideal for a relaxing drink. The bar area includes a lounge. There is a restaurant serving British food nearly 5 minutes' walk away.
Leisure & Business
Also, the Francis Hotel Bath has a sundeck, spa therapy, and a shared lounge on the premises.
